The big crowd for the Tête de moine

The organizers indicate this Sunday, May 1st to have benefited from ideal weather conditions. They qualify this edition as successful, “like the masterful hay statues made for the occasion and the magnificent scene of raw milk with the children sculpted by Jean-Pierre Froidevaux on a six-meter scale”.

The Vacherin Friborg AOP sector was the guest of honour. The event coincided with the 40th anniversary of the chanterelle, the instrument invented to cleanly scrape this unique cheese.

On Saturday and Sunday, visitors were able to attend the production of Tête de moine and Vacherin from Friborg or take on the role of judge during the evaluation of different Tête de moine from regional producers.

Bellelay Abbey hosted the international competition for the best cheese platter.
